About TFS

Founded in 1985, Tradition Financial Services (TFS) is a market leader in the inter-dealer brokering of OTC physical and derivative products. With offices in the world's major financial centers, the Company covers global foreign exchange, commodity, equity, freight, precious metals, property and pulp & paper markets. Additionally, the TFS Energy division brokers energy and derivative products. TFS's extensive client base includes banks and financial institutions, energy companies and utilities, insurance companies, paper producers and printers, shipping and chartering firms, newspaper and media groups, and leading consumer products companies.

About TFS Energy

TFS Energy brokers a full spectrum of energy and energy-related markets with OTC businesses operational globally in electricity, natural gas, crude oil and refined products, coal, environmental products, and weather derivatives. Its full-service desks in Stamford, New York, Houston, London, Frankfurt, Sydney, Singapore and Johannesburg provide futures and OTC specialist trade execution, research and market analysis to hundreds of investment banks, commercial banks, energy producers, utilities, trading companies and consumers. Today, it employs over 125 voice brokers, and has dedicated NYMEX floor clerks in natural gas and crude oil.

TFS Energy was established in 1989 to specialize in derivatives across the whole energy spectrum. In August of 2000, TFS's U.S. subsidiary TFS, Inc. merged with the former energy group of Sakura Dellsher Inc. (SDI Energy) to form TFS Energy, LLC, which further enhanced its coverage of U.S.-based energy markets.

About Compagnie Financière Tradition (CFT)

TFS is part of Compagnie Financière Tradition (CFT), one of the world’s top three brokers in OTC financial  (money markets, bond markets, interest rate, currency and credit derivatives, equity derivatives, exchange-traded products) and non-financial products (energy, precious metals, pulp and paper, etc.), and number one in continental Europe. Headquartered in Lausanne, Switzerland, CFT has a presence in 21 countries worldwide. With over 2,200 employees, CFT services its 7,000 clients, which include global banks, financial institutions, and local authorities, major industrial and commercial corporations.

Compagnie Financière Tradition reaffirms its position as a world leader with consolidated turnover reaching 786.1 million euro in 2003. CFT’s shares have been listed on the Swiss Stock Exchange (CFT) since 1973 and on the third compartment of the Frankfurt Stock Exchange since 1999.

Both TFS and CFT are subsidiaries of VIEL & Cie (www.viel.com), which is based in Paris, France, and is continental Europe's top financial brokerage firm.
